| Value of Magnetic Resonance Imaging Parameters Combined with Lumbodorsal Surface Electromyography Parameters in Evaluating Postoperative Lumbar Function in Patients with Lumbar Spinal Stenosis |

Abstract 【Objective】 To evaluate the diagnostic value of combining mag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) parameters with surface electromyography (sEMG) of the lumbar paraspinal muscles in assessing postoperative lumbar function in patients with lumbar spinal stenosis (LSS). 【Methods】 A total of 63 LSS patients who underwent endoscopic decompression surgery at our hospital between February 2023 and June 2024 were enrolled. Based on their lumbar functional outcomes at 3 months postoperatively, they were divided into an improvement group and a non-improvement group. Additionally, 31 healthy individuals of similar age who underwent routine physical examinations at the same period were selected as the control group. MRI parameters and sEMG parameters of the paraspinal muscles were compared among the three groups: the improvement group, non-improvement group at 3 months post-surgery and the control group during physical examination. The diagnostic value of MRI parameters and sEMG parameters for postoperative lumbar function was assessed using receiver operating characteristic (ROC) curve analysis. 【Results】 Among the 63 LSS patients, 30.16% (19/63) showed no improvement after surgery. The spinal canal area, sagittal diameter, transverse diameter, and dural sac area in both the control group and the improvement group were significantly larger than those in the non-improvement group. Similarly, the integrated electromyography (IEMG) and mean power frequency (MPF) values were higher in the improvement and control groups compared to the non-improvement group, with all differences being statistically significant (P<0.05). ROC analysis revealed that the combination of MRI parameters and sEMG parameters yielded higher accuracy, sensitivity, and specificity in diagnosing postoperative lumbar function in LSS patients compared to either MRI or sEMG alone. 【Conclusion】 The combined use of MRI parameters and sEMG of the lumbar paraspinal muscles has high diagnostic value for assessing postoperative lumbar function in LSS patients.
